A friend of mine from the "dark side" used this technique to determine my initial which is 16 deg. He slowly advanced the distributer and watched for throttle response. hesitation etc. It seems the more advanced he went, the better it got. Of course, he eventually reached the "hard to start" point and then backed up until he had the best of both worlds. Now knowing where initial was, it was simply subtract 16 from 36 and that gave the number for the limiting cam in the distributor. Set the spring to bring the 20 deg in by 2600 rpm and I haven't looked back.
